Understanding Black Soldier Fly Larvae


Black Soldier Fly larvae are the immature form of the Black Soldier Fly, a species known for its ability to convert organic waste into high-quality protein. These larvae thrive on decomposing organic matter, making them an excellent option for recycling food waste and agricultural by-products.


Nutritional Profile of BSF Larvae


BSF larvae are rich in essential nutrients, making them a valuable addition to animal diets. Here are some key components of their nutritional profile:


  • High Protein Content: BSF larvae contain approximately 40-50% protein, which is comparable to traditional protein sources like fish meal and soybean meal.

  • Healthy Fats: They are also rich in healthy fats, providing essential fatty acids necessary for animal growth and development.

  • Vitamins and Minerals: BSF larvae are a good source of vitamins such as B vitamins and minerals like calcium and phosphorus, which are crucial for animal health.


Environmental Benefits of Using BSF Larvae


The environmental impact of traditional animal feed production is significant, contributing to deforestation, greenhouse gas emissions, and water pollution. In contrast, using BSF larvae offers several environmental benefits:


Waste Reduction


BSF larvae can effectively convert organic waste into protein. By utilizing food scraps, agricultural residues, and other organic materials, they help reduce the volume of waste sent to landfills. This waste reduction is crucial for minimizing environmental pollution and promoting a circular economy.


Lower Carbon Footprint


The production of BSF larvae has a lower carbon footprint compared to conventional animal feed sources. They require less land, water, and energy to produce, making them a more sustainable option. For instance, producing one kilogram of BSF larvae can require up to 90% less water than producing the same amount of soybeans.


Biodiversity Preservation


By reducing the reliance on traditional feed crops, the use of BSF larvae can help preserve biodiversity. Large-scale monoculture farming for feed crops often leads to habitat destruction and loss of species. BSF larvae farming can be integrated into existing agricultural systems, promoting biodiversity and ecosystem health.


Economic Advantages of BSF Larvae


In addition to their environmental benefits, BSF larvae also present economic advantages for farmers and the agricultural industry.


Cost-Effective Feed Source


BSF larvae can be produced at a lower cost compared to traditional feed sources. Their ability to thrive on organic waste means that farmers can utilize locally available materials, reducing feed costs. This cost-effectiveness can significantly improve the profitability of livestock and aquaculture operations.


Job Creation


The growing BSF larvae industry has the potential to create jobs in waste management, farming, and feed production. As more farmers adopt this sustainable practice, new opportunities for employment and entrepreneurship will arise, contributing to local economies.


Applications of BSF Larvae in Animal Feed


BSF larvae can be used in various animal feed applications, making them a versatile option for different livestock and aquaculture species.


Poultry


In poultry farming, BSF larvae can be incorporated into chicken feed to enhance growth rates and improve overall health. Studies have shown that chickens fed with BSF larvae exhibit better feed conversion ratios and higher weight gain compared to those fed traditional feed.


Swine


For swine production, BSF larvae can serve as a protein-rich supplement in pig diets. The inclusion of BSF larvae in pig feed has been linked to improved growth performance and feed efficiency, making them an attractive option for pig farmers.


Aquaculture


BSF larvae are also gaining popularity in aquaculture as a sustainable feed alternative for fish and shrimp. Their high protein content and favorable amino acid profile make them an excellent choice for promoting healthy growth in aquatic species.


Challenges and Considerations


While the benefits of BSF larvae as animal feed are significant, there are also challenges and considerations to keep in mind.


Regulatory Framework


The use of BSF larvae in animal feed is subject to regulatory approval in many countries. Farmers and producers must navigate these regulations to ensure compliance and safety in feed production.


Consumer Acceptance


Consumer acceptance of BSF larvae as animal feed is still evolving. Education and awareness campaigns may be necessary to inform consumers about the benefits and safety of using insect-based feed.


Production Scalability


Scaling up BSF larvae production to meet the growing demand for animal feed can be challenging. Investment in technology and infrastructure is essential to ensure efficient and sustainable production practices.
